Currently I am using an upgraded HP 200 LX (8 Meg / double
speed). A problem occurred however when I wanted to use the
Accurite Travel Floppy 144 with my palmtop computer. To install
the Accurite Travel Floppy 144 driver, I updated the CONFIG.SYS
as follows:

device=\spd31.sys
buffers=20
files=30
lastdrive=j
device=\fdhppalm.sys

The first line in the config.sys is required to install the
driver for the HP200LX to run on double speed.
The last 4 lines are required for the Accurite Travel Floppy
144 (according to instructions in the User's Guide).

After boot-up with this config.sys I get the following message
regarding the Travel Floppy:

DEVICE ASSIGNED TO LOGICAL DRIVE F:
SOCKET SERVICES RELEASE (1.00) VENDOR VERSION (0.00)

So the above message does not report any errors. But when I try
to use the Travel Floppy, I get the message that the drive is
not ready or could not be found.

Next I changed the config.sys in such a way that I installed
the Travel Floppy driver first and the driver SPD31.SYS as the
last driver in the config.sys. But in this case the HP 200 LX
could again not communicate with the Travel Floppy. In a next
attempt I left the driver SPD31.SYS out of the config.sys, but
with the same result (and a right shifted screen / garbled
screen one can expect if this driver is not loaded).

Then I tried the Travel Floppy on a not-upgraded HP 200 LX (2
MB version), with the same config.sys (but without installing
the spd31.sys driver of course). In this case the Travel Floppy
worked flawlessy.

It seems to me that the upgrade of the HP 200 LX is interfering
with the communication between the HP 200 LX and the Accurite
Travel Floppy 144. So I tested the PCACIA slot in the HP200LX
with other PCMCIA cards. I used a PCMCIA modemcard (14k4) and
memory cards in the PCMCIA-slot of the HP200LX without any
problems. A driver to recognize the modem card is loaded with
autoexec.bat and for the memory card no additional drivers are
required.

From Times2Tech (that installed the double speed option in the
HP200LX) I received supporting information and from Accurite an
updated driver, but it did not solve the problem.

Is there someone who can give me a clue of how to solve the
problem or know where I can find tests I can ran just to find
what part (HP200LX, PCMCIA-controller, Accurite Travel Floppy
Drive, Accurite Travel Floppy PCMCIA controller card) is causing
the problem.
